A 2000 kilogram car moves down a level highway under the actions of two forces: a 970 Newton forward force exerted on the drive wheels by the road and a 920 Newton resistive force. Use the work-energy theorem to evaluate the speed of the car after it has moved a distance of 35 meter, assuming that it starts from rest.
